Sometimes, there's so much to say,

Yet words escape, and silence stays.

A longing to converse, to share and to tell,

But reasons falter, and the moment's lost to dwell.


An awkwardness lingers, a feeling so hard to define,

A sense of disconnection, a heart that's left behind.

I type out a message, only to delete it with a sigh,

Ending every conversation with a hasty "bye" or "okay, I'll try".


Oh, how I yearn for understanding, for someone to see,

The turmoil that's brewing, the emotions that are me.

If I'm silent, don't assume it's indifference or disdain,

Perhaps it's just the weight of words unspoken, the pain.


If I don't respond, please don't hesitate to reach out,

Send a message, a gentle nudge, a heartfelt "what's it all about?"

Let's break the silence, let's bridge the gap,

And find a way to connect, to heal, to mend the fracture, and to map.


– Goldi Mishra
